FALANGE ESPAÑOLA  
Founded in 1933 by José Antonio Primo de Rivera, son of the dictator Miguel Primo de Rivera, the  Falange Española was a sort of paramilitary fascist party. It grew rapidly in the early months of the Spanish Civil War, particularly after its leader was executed by the Republicans. Franco later merged the  Falange with the  Carlistas to form the  Falange Española Tradicionalista de las Juntas de Ofensiva Nacional-Sindicalista. After the Civil War, the  FET de las JONS was the only legally political party permitted in Franco's Spain. The  Falange is still in existence.
